Dead Cells Will Receive More DLC and Free Updates for “At Least” Another Year

Motion Twin says it's "very, very excited" about some of the content that's coming to the side-scrolling action roguelite.

Action roguelite Dead Cells received a new free update today with “Break the Bank”, continuing the post-launch support that’s followed since its August 2018 release. Motion Twin has been fairly upfront about the cadence of its updates and how purchasing paid DLC helps to support the studio.

In the release announcement for its latest update, the developer briefly discussed its “future plans.” It confirmed that there would be more DLC and free updates for “at least another year.” Some of the content also has the team “very, very excited” but we’ll have to wait for more details. Motion Twin also has a new project in the works though it may be a while until it’s official revealed.

Dead Cells currently has three paid DLC – The Bad Seed, Fatal Falls and The Queen and the Sea – which are considered as part of a concluded trilogy. New content added over free over the past several years includes new biomes, weapons and enemies; several changes and rebalances to systems like Malaise; features like the Backpack, Aspects, the Training Room, and a World Map; and much more, including a crossover with several other franchises.
